.styles_modalBackdrop__cnjpX{position:fixed;inset:0;width:100vw;height:100vh;display:flex;background:rgba(0,0,0,.5);z-index:var(--index-modal)}.styles_modal__qEgcS{background:var(--clr-newsletter);border-radius:var(--borderRadius);box-shadow:0 10px 30px rgba(0,0,0,.15);width:min(640px,92vw);margin:auto;border:1px solid var(--clr-border);overflow:hidden}.styles_modalHeader__DEV5k{position:relative;display:flex;align-items:center;justify-content:space-between;padding:var(--spacing-md) var(--spacing-lg);border-bottom:1px solid var(--clr-border);background:var(--clr-card-light)}.styles_modalTitle__RJ1vl{font-size:var(--text-xl);font-weight:700;margin:0}.styles_input_multi_select__zJG5L{border:1px solid var(--clr-border)}.styles_select_input_padding__RAUOd{padding:.75rem!important}.styles_closeBtn__jPPij{all:unset;cursor:pointer;position:absolute;right:var(--spacing-lg);top:calc(var(--spacing-md) - 2px);color:var(--clr-text);opacity:.7}.styles_closeBtn__jPPij:hover{opacity:1}.styles_closeIcon__Q36_D{width:24px;height:24px}.styles_modalBody__X2Obr{padding:var(--spacing-lg);display:flex;flex-direction:column;gap:var(--spacing-md)}.styles_formRow__rTeMu{display:flex;flex-direction:column;gap:.25rem}.styles_label__rwv_m{font-size:var(--text-base);color:var(--clr-background-secondary);margin-bottom:var(--spacing-sm)}.styles_formRow__rTeMu .styles_input__dEgfK{height:2.375rem;border-radius:var(--borderRadius);border:1px solid var(--clr-border);padding:var(--spacing-base);font-size:var(--text-base)}.styles_input__dEgfK:focus{outline:2px solid #1e47a9;box-shadow:0 0 10px #b7d2f9,0 0 0 10px rgba(183,210,249,0)}.styles_selectContainer__CyJIm{position:relative}.styles_selectControl___AbRl{min-height:2.375rem;border:1px solid var(--clr-border);border-radius:var(--borderRadius);padding:var(--spacing-sm) var(--spacing-sm);display:flex;align-items:center;gap:.375rem;cursor:pointer;flex-wrap:wrap;background-color:var(--clr-background-secondary)}.styles_selectControl___AbRl:focus-visible{outline:2px solid #1e47a9}.styles_placeholder__0gu2G{color:var(--clr-placeholder);font-size:var(--text-base)}.styles_chipList__hiRSy{display:flex;flex-wrap:wrap;gap:.375rem}.styles_chip__79L7G{position:relative;display:inline-flex;align-items:center;gap:var(--spacing-sm);padding:var(--spacing-sm) var(--spacing-sm);background:var(--clr-secondary);border-radius:var(--spacing-sm);line-height:1}.styles_chipText__ZVQLq{font-size:var(--text-sm-base)}.styles_chipRemove__pAEP_{all:unset;cursor:pointer;width:16px;height:16px;display:inline-grid;place-items:center;border-radius:999px;color:var(--clr-text);opacity:0;transition:opacity .15s ease}.styles_chip__79L7G:hover .styles_chipRemove__pAEP_{opacity:1}.styles_caret__tbwbk{margin-left:auto;width:18px;height:18px;color:var(--color-gray)}.styles_options__wF_cM{position:absolute;left:0;right:0;top:calc(100% + .2rem);background:var(--clr-background-secondary);border:1px solid var(--clr-border);border-radius:var(--borderRadius);box-shadow:0 10px 30px rgba(0,0,0,.12);max-height:18rem;overflow-y:auto;z-index:var(--index-dropdown)}.styles_option__6wwp8{display:flex;align-items:center;gap:var(--spacing-sm);padding:var(--spacing-sm) var(--spacing-sm);cursor:pointer}.styles_optionSelected__Ta3bV,.styles_option__6wwp8:hover{background:var(--clr-card-light)}.styles_radioGroup__KVjFx{display:flex;flex-wrap:wrap;color:var(--clr-background-secondary)}.styles_radioGroup__KVjFx,.styles_radioLabel__y4wwu{gap:var(--spacing-sm);font-size:var(--text-sm-base);font-weight:400;margin-bottom:var(--spacing-sm)}.styles_radioLabel__y4wwu{display:inline-flex;align-items:center;padding:var(--spacing-sm) var(--spacing-sm);border:1px solid var(--clr-border);border-radius:.375rem;background:var(--clr-background-secondary);color:var(--clr-text)}.styles_radio__PiTSU{accent-color:var(--clr-primary)}.styles_actions__8iKOh{display:flex;justify-content:flex-end;gap:var(--spacing-sm);margin-top:var(--spacing-md)}.styles_button_mail__m4diq{background-color:var(--clr-primary)!important;border-radius:8px;box-shadow:0 4px 6px rgba(0,0,0,.2)}.styles_button_mail__m4diq:hover{background-color:var(--clr-secondary)!important;box-shadow:0 6px 8px rgba(0,0,0,.3);color:var(--clr-text)}.Styles_input_container__qcCzf{flex:1 1}.Styles_input__dt3RG{padding:1.06rem 1.5rem;outline:none;border:none;border-radius:.5rem;width:100%;font-size:var(--text-base);font-family:var(--font-lato);font-style:normal;font-weight:400;line-height:1.5rem}.Styles_input__dt3RG::placeholder{color:var(--clr-placeholder);font-family:var(--font-lato);font-size:1rem;font-weight:400;line-height:1.5rem}.Styles_invalid_message__8vrqQ{font-size:var(--text-base);font-style:normal;font-weight:400;line-height:1.5rem;color:red;margin-top:.5rem}.Styles_border__TKWUK{border:1.5px solid var(--clr-border)}@media (max-width:768px){.Styles_input__dt3RG{padding:1rem}}.Styles_container__HVALw{width:100%;max-width:25.5rem;position:relative}.Styles_formContainer__kGAii{width:100%;background-color:#fff;padding:var(--spacing-lg) 20px var(--spacing-md);border-radius:var(--border-radius)}@media (max-width:820px){.Styles_formContainer__kGAii{width:95vw}}.Styles_heading__XsEZZ{font-size:var(--text-md);font-weight:700;line-height:1.35;margin:0 var(--spacing-xl) var(--spacing-md) 0}.Styles_banner__3MWvW{background:rgba(245,200,81,.1);border:1px solid rgba(245,200,81,.35);border-radius:var(--borderRadius);padding:var(--spacing-base) 14px;margin-bottom:14px;display:flex;flex-direction:column}.Styles_bannerHeader__dLJMn{display:flex;align-items:center;gap:10px;margin-bottom:6px}.Styles_bannerIcon__ewiM2{background-color:#f8c950;padding:.375rem;border-radius:9999px;color:#000;flex-shrink:0;display:flex;align-items:center;justify-content:center}.Styles_bannerIconSvg__nX4Tf{width:16px;height:16px}.Styles_bannerTitle__0l3cw{font-weight:700;color:#111827;font-size:11px;text-transform:uppercase;letter-spacing:.07em;line-height:1;margin:0}.Styles_bannerText__oFgNQ{margin:0}.Styles_bannerSubheading__bTRVW,.Styles_bannerText__oFgNQ{color:#4b5563;font-size:var(--text-sm-base);line-height:1.4}.Styles_bannerSubheading__bTRVW{margin:10px 0 0}.Styles_bannerHighlight__PAkQB{color:#111827;font-weight:700;font-size:var(--text-sm-base)}.Styles_appliedFilters__SdnNk{position:relative;background:#faf6ec;border:1px solid #efe5c4;border-radius:12px;padding:.75rem 1rem .875rem 1.375rem;margin-bottom:14px;overflow:hidden}.Styles_appliedFiltersStripe__oeRG6{position:absolute;left:0;top:0;bottom:0;width:4px;background:var(--clr-primary)}.Styles_appliedFiltersHeader__2roal{display:flex;align-items:center;justify-content:space-between;margin-bottom:.625rem}.Styles_appliedFiltersEyebrow__CEvKX{font-size:.65625rem;font-weight:800;letter-spacing:.14em;text-transform:uppercase;color:#4b5563;line-height:1}.Styles_undoButton__Wkt9k{background:transparent;border:none;cursor:pointer;padding:0;margin-top:8px;color:var(--clr-accent);font-family:inherit;display:inline-flex;align-items:center;gap:.25rem;line-height:1}.Styles_undoButton__Wkt9k svg{width:.875rem;height:.875rem}.Styles_undoButton__Wkt9k:hover{opacity:.7}.Styles_undoButtonSpan__4oEEb{color:var(--clr-accent);font-size:.75rem;font-weight:700;line-height:1;font-family:inherit;text-decoration:underline}.Styles_chipGroup__95SfM{display:flex;flex-direction:column;gap:.3125rem;margin-bottom:.5rem}.Styles_chipGroup__95SfM:last-child{margin-bottom:0}.Styles_chipGroupHeader__OxiE9{display:flex;align-items:center;gap:.5rem}.Styles_chipGroupLabel__T9647{font-size:.65625rem;font-weight:800;letter-spacing:.08em;text-transform:uppercase;color:#4b5563;line-height:1;white-space:nowrap}.Styles_chipGroupLine__VVycQ{flex:1 1;height:1px;background:#efe5c4}.Styles_chipRow__zLFsw{display:flex;flex-wrap:wrap;gap:.375rem;align-items:center;margin-top:6px}.Styles_inputContainer__G8zWN{margin-bottom:14px}.Styles_inputContainer__G8zWN .Styles_input__xwsAj{width:100%;height:3rem;padding:0 20px;font-size:var(--text-sm-base);border:1px solid #dfe1e5;border-radius:5px;outline:none}.Styles_inputFocused__7ZhMt:focus{outline:2px solid #1e47a9;box-shadow:0 0 7px #b7d2f9,0 0 0 7px #b7d2f9}.Styles_inputError__Pxo_0,.Styles_inputError__Pxo_0:focus{outline:2px solid #b91e1e;box-shadow:none}.Styles_checkboxContainer__xeGY9{margin-bottom:14px;display:flex;width:100%;flex-direction:column;gap:10px}.Styles_checkboxContainer__xeGY9 button{border:1px solid var(--clr-border,#666);border-radius:.25rem}.Styles_checkboxContainer__xeGY9 label,.Styles_checkboxContainer__xeGY9 p,.Styles_checkboxContainer__xeGY9 span{font-size:var(--text-sm-base)}.Styles_terms__82cYy a{color:#000}.Styles_formActions__ycEV_{width:100%}.Styles_submitButton__PuW_K{width:100%;display:flex;gap:5px}.Styles_submitButton__PuW_K:hover{background-color:var(--clr-secondary);box-shadow:0 6px 8px rgba(0,0,0,.3)}.Styles_inner_container___r02j{max-width:30.625rem;width:clamp(100%,100vw,30.625rem)}.Styles_inner_container___r02j,.Styles_inner_container___r02j form{display:flex;flex-direction:column}.Styles_inner_container___r02j form button{margin:0 auto}.Styles_inner_container___r02j h1{font-size:var(--text-2xl);margin:clamp(2rem,5vw,5rem) 0 .5rem;font-family:var(--font-lora);font-weight:600;line-height:normal;text-align:center}.Styles_inner_container___r02j>p{margin:0 0 2rem;text-align:center;font-size:1.125rem;font-weight:500;line-height:1.625rem}.Styles_input_container__ikAY_:first-of-type{margin-bottom:1.5rem}.Styles_input_field__kuFm8{border:1px solid var(--clr-border);border-radius:var(--borderRadius);height:2.6875rem;margin-top:.63rem;padding-left:.98rem}.Styles_button__kDizv{margin:2rem auto 5rem!important;width:12.125rem;height:2.6875rem;justify-content:center}@media (max-width:820px){.Styles_inner_container___r02j{padding:var(--spacing-md)}}